After celebrating the Hungarian election results (with a little help from some Bilum yarns), we discuss shushing the shh…, (ft. a diversion into engineering disaster that is Georgia’s undergrad library), an errata on merino wool staple length, and finally – Knitting in Public. 


Prompted by a lovely email from a listener we explore the social dynamics, privilege, assumptions about gender and sexuality, concert knitting etiquette and why Georgia had to do a chicken dance this weekend somewhere very fancy.
